Types of Air Pumps I Considered
I found that there are a few main types of pumps to choose from:
- Hand pumps: These are simple, portable, and affordable. I like them for occasional use.
- Foot pumps: These let me inflate the ball without using my hands, which felt more comfortable for larger balls.
- Electric pumps: These are the fastest and easiest for me, especially when I needed to inflate more than one ball.
- Dual-action pumps: These push air on both up and down strokes, so I noticed they filled the ball faster than basic pumps.

Choosing Between Manual and Electric
In my experience, manual pumps are great if I want something inexpensive and easy to store. Electric pumps, on the other hand, are best when I value speed and convenience. If I only inflate my stability ball once in a while, a manual pump is enough. But if I need regular use or have multiple fitness items to inflate, I prefer electric.
Size and Valve Fit Matter
One thing I learned the hard way is that the nozzle has to fit properly. Even a good pump can be frustrating if the attachment doesn’t match the ball’s valve. I always check the product description to confirm it works with stability balls, exercise balls, or yoga balls before I buy.
